The Cyber Boxing Zone Encyclopedia -- Title Contender

Gerald "Tuffy" Griffiths
(Gerald Ambrose Griffiths)
("Jerry"; the "Pender Pounder")

BORN   1907; Sioux City, Iowa (Some sources report Albion or Macy, Nebraska)
DIED November 15 1968; Sheridan, Wyoming
HEIGHT 5-11
WEIGHT 159-190 lbs
MANAGER Jack O'Keefe

Griffiths was a scrapper who battled most of the top men of his time; He lost but 11 verdicts in 88 bouts and scored 42 knockouts; During his career, he was a top contender in the Heavyweight and Light-Heavyweight Divisions

He defeated such men as Mike McTigue, Harry Dillon, King Levinsky, Tom Heeney, Johnny Risko, Paulino Uzcudun, Leo Lomski, Charley Belaner, Otto Von Porat, Emmett Rocco, Jack Roper, Paul Pantaleo, Con O'Kelly, Jack Gannon, Clarence "Sandy" Seifert, Sully Montgomery, Clayton "Big Boy" Peterson, Ludwig Haymann and Tommy O'Brien

"Tuffy" was inducted into the
Greater Siouxland Athletic Association Hall of Fame in 1981
